will declare for the NFL draft according to the Post and Courier. Bryant told the newspaper in a text message: "I have decided to enter the draft, it's best for me and my family."

Bryant caught 42 passes for 828 yards and seven touchdowns this season including two touchdowns in Clemson's win in the Orange Bowl over Ohio State.

Wide receiver Sammy Watkins and cornerback Bashaud Breeland have also been reported to be leaving Clemson early.

UPDATE: Clemson SID Tim Bourret told TigerNet that there will be no official release on juniors leaving for the NFL until Dabo Swinney has a chance to talk to the players on Tuesday.
